My Buying Guides on Instant Pot Replacement Cord

Why I Needed a Replacement Cord

When my Instant Pot cord started showing signs of wear, I realized how important it is to replace it with the right one. A damaged cord can affect performance and safety, so I knew I had to look for a reliable replacement instead of taking chances.

What I Looked for First

The first thing I checked was compatibility. Not every cord fits every Instant Pot model, so I made sure the replacement matched my exact pressure cooker version. I also looked at the plug type, voltage rating, and overall cord length to make sure it would work well in my kitchen.

Safety Features I Considered

Safety was my biggest concern. I preferred a cord that was UL-listed or certified by a trusted safety standard. I also looked for sturdy insulation, a secure connection, and heat-resistant materials because I wanted something that could handle regular use without issues.

Build Quality and Durability

I found that a good replacement cord should feel solid, not flimsy. I paid attention to the thickness of the wire, the quality of the connector, and whether the cord seemed flexible but strong. A well-made cord usually lasts longer and gives me more confidence while cooking.

Cord Length and Convenience

Cord length mattered more than I expected. My kitchen setup needed a cord that was long enough to reach the outlet comfortably, but not so long that it created clutter. I chose a length that fit my counter space and made storage easier.

Brand and Model Compatibility

I always double-check whether the replacement cord is made for my specific Instant Pot model. Some cords are designed for certain series only, and using the wrong one can cause fit problems or poor performance. I found that reading product descriptions carefully saved me from buying the wrong item.

Price vs. Value

While I didn’t want to overspend, I also avoided the cheapest option just because it was inexpensive. For me, the best choice was a cord that balanced price, safety, and durability. I’d rather pay a little more for peace of mind than replace a low-quality cord again soon.

Where I Prefer to Buy

I usually look at trusted retailers, the Instant Pot brand store, or reputable online marketplaces with clear return policies. That way, if the cord doesn’t fit or meet my expectations, I have an easier time exchanging it.

My Final Tip Before Buying

Before I place an order, I always compare the product photos, read customer reviews, and confirm the model number one last time. That small step has helped me avoid mistakes and choose a replacement cord that works safely and reliably.
